4-20 Torque Limit Factor Source
Option:
Function:
Select an analog input for scaling the
settings in 4-16 Torque Limit Motor
Mode and 4-17 Torque Limit Generator
Mode from 0% to 100% (or inverse).
The signal levels corresponding to 0%
and 100% are defined in the analog
input scaling, e.g. parameter group
6-1*. This parameter is only active
when 1-00 Configuration Mode is in
Speed Open Loop or Speed Closed
Loop.

4-21 Speed Limit Factor SourceOption
Option:
Function:
Select an analog input for scaling the
settings in 4-19 Max Output Frequency
from 0% to 100% (or vice versa). The
signal levels corresponding to 0%
and 100% are defined in the analog
input scaling, e.g. parameter group
6-1*. This parameter is only active
when 1-00 Configuration Mode is in
Torque Mode.
